Job Description

The Platinum Hotel is looking for a full time Front Desk Agent. We’re the perfect team to join if you’re looking for a non-union, non-smoking & non-gaming work environment.  Located just 1 block off the strip, and 5 blocks from UNLV, you’re guaranteed an easy trip to work and free meals &  employee parking.

The Front Desk agent will be responsible for registration and checkout, phone operations, mail and message service all the while providing outstanding service to our guests along the way. Starting pay is $16.50/hr. Shift times vary between 6am - 10pm

What you will be doing:

  • Review arrivals noting special requests, blocking rooms as needed.
  • Check in and out hotel guests in a confident, professional and friendly manner.
  • Answer all phone calls promptly and knowledgeably, always ensuring complete and accurate information.
  • Complete all items on  checklist by end of shift.
  • Conduct pre-assignment of hotel rooms, which includes VIPS, repeat guests, all packages, and any special requests.
  • Follow established key control policy.
  • Ensure proper credit policies are followed.
  • Open, secure, and balance out daily shift bank, which involves counting and verifying cash, check, and credit card transactions occurring while on duty.
  • Monitor room availability throughout the day.
  • Research guest requests and create memorable amenities.

Marcus Corporation

Headquartered in Milwaukee, Marcus Corporation (NYSE: MCS) is a leader in the entertainment and hospitality industries, with significant company-owned real estate assets. The Marcus Corporation’s theatre division, Marcus Theatres, is the fourth largest theatre circuit in the U.S. and currently owns or operates 985 screens at 78 locations in 17 states under the Marcus Theatres, Movie Tavern® by Marcus and BistroPlex® brands. The company’s lodging division, Marcus Hotels & Resorts, owns and/or manages 17 hotels, resorts and other properties in eight states.
